Helen Skelton Biography
| Detail | Information |
|---|---|
| Full Name | Helen Elizabeth Skelton |
| Date of Birth | July 19, 1983 |
| Age | 41 (approx.) |
| Profession | Television Presenter, Actress |
| Nationality | British |
| Net Worth (approx.) | $5–6 million |
| Notable Works / Achievements | Blue Peter, Countryfile, Sports Broadcasting |
Helen Skelton has built her reputation through years of varied broadcasting, from children’s television to serious sports coverage. Her adaptability and warmth are central to her appeal.
Gethin Jones Biography
| Detail | Information |
|---|---|
| Full Name | Gethin Clifford Jones |
| Date of Birth | February 12, 1978 |
| Age | 47 (approx.) |
| Profession | Television Presenter |
| Nationality | Welsh |
| Net Worth (approx.) | $2–3 million |
| Notable Works / Achievements | Blue Peter, Morning Television, Reality TV |
Gethin Jones is known for his easygoing presence, clear communication style, and ability to connect with both guests and viewers.
